The Shoreline Gap

Land-based tools stop at the water's edge. Pollution doesn't.

Bioswales, retention ponds, and street sweeping do valuable work on land. But once stormwater runoff crosses the shoreline into the water column, no infrastructure intercepts it. Sediment settles on habitat. Nutrients drive algal blooms. Bacteria spreads through shellfish beds and swimming areas.

PEARL was built to close that gap. We deploy treatment systems directly in the water, at the point where pollution concentrates and ecosystems are most stressed.

How It Works

Multi-Stage Active Filtration

Three treatment stages work together: physical pre-treatment removes large solids, chemical polishing targets dissolved nutrients, and biological filtration through live oyster raceways handles what remains.

PEARL Multi-Stage Active Filtration — 3 tanks: Pre-Treatment, Chemical Stage, Biological Stage
01

Physical Pre-Treatment

Minnow trap entry, 500µm mesh screen, and gravity settling remove large debris, sediment, and suspended solids before water enters the chemical stage.

02

Chemical Polishing

Zeolite, biochar, and nitrogen/phosphorus resin media adsorb dissolved nutrients and contaminants that physical filtration cannot capture.

03

Biological Filtration

Live oyster raceways filter particles down to 2µm, naturally removing bacteria, phytoplankton, and fine sediment. A 50µm final screen ensures clean effluent.

Deployment

Built to Go Where the Problem Is

PEARL systems are modular and relocatable. They can be deployed from a vessel in tidal estuaries or mounted at fixed outfall points for permanent compliance.

PEARL deployment configurations — vessel-mounted and fixed dockside

Vessel-Mounted Platform

Mobile treatment for tidal, estuarine, and brackish environments. No land acquisition required and simplified permitting. Repositionable based on seasonal conditions.

Fixed Dockside System

Permanent infrastructure for freshwater MS4 outfalls, PFAS hotspots, and year-round compliance points. Smaller footprint for constrained sites.

More Than a Filter

Every unit is a data node.

Each PEARL system carries 8 monitoring points that capture influent and effluent data in real time — TSS, turbidity, nutrients, microplastics, and dissolved oxygen. That data feeds directly into the PEARL Intelligence Network.

Paired with federal datasets from USGS, EPA, and NOAA, every deployment adds resolution to a national picture of water quality. Treatment and monitoring become the same infrastructure.
